➔The electrical connection may only be set up by an electrician. ➔ The arrangement of the components depends on the structural conditions and the
gate design. ➔ Switch off the operating voltage before working on the system. ➔ The switching device monitors pressure-sensitive protective devices
from Bircher Reglomat AG (proper use). ➔ Use of components not supplied by Bircher-Reglomat (including safety edges) will render the guarantee and
liability null and void. ➔Connect all operating and switching voltages to the same fuse. ➔Connect the operating voltage to the same circuit as the indu-
strial door controller. ➔Disconnect device from mains in the event of a fault. ➔Protection max. 10 A

Please read chapters 5.1 to 5.3 in full before attempting configuration.
Activatin confi uration menu
5.1
Status LED flashes orange,
press «Data» button
Press the «Mode» and «Data» buttons
simultaneously for 2 s.
Configuration menu is activated.

Dia nostic menu
4
Press the «Mode»and «Data»buttons simultaneously for 2 s ➔status LED flashes orange. Press «Mode»button briefly to change to the next mode.
Press the «Mode»button for 2 s to exit diagnostic menu.
